RGT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review
47 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Royce Global Value Trust (RGT)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$41M — up 19% from $34.3M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 7 funds closed out of RGT and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 18 trimmed existing stakes and 7 added.
The largest buyer was Raymond James & Associates, adding an estimated $2.86M. The largest seller was Punch & Associates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.33M sold.
